A Central Hardin High School student has been killed in a two-vehicle crash in Elizabethtown.
The victim, 16-year-old Ethan English, was a junior, according to a report by the News-Enterprise. The newspaper said the accident occurred on College Street Road Saturday afternoon.
While driving east, English lost control of his 2002 Camaro while driving in a curve on the wet roadway, crossed into the westbound lane where the vehicle was struck on the driver’s side by a Ford Excursion, being driven by 46-year-old Kenneth Howson, of Crestwood, according to the News-Enterprise.
English was pronounced dead at the scene by the Hardin County Coroner’s Office. Howson was not injured.
